Add overall estimated time remaining to Progressable#15
Conversation
This adds `getOverallEstimatedTimeRemaining()` to `Progressable` to bring feature parity with local `getEstimatedTimeRemaining()`. It calculates the ETA based on the overall progress of all instances. It also updates `toArray()` to export `overall_estimated_time_remaining` alongside `estimated_time_remaining`. Includes time-mocked unit tests for ETA calculation.
